JAPANESE EARLY 20th CENTURY ART NOUVEAU VASE |
 |
Inventory #: U-3373 |
Japanese early 20th Century bronze Art Nouveau vase with medium relief leaf & three dimensional stem design. Dark brown patina on body and red finish on leaves.
Bottom replaced with antique Japanese metal mirror; no signature.
Measurements: Height 7 1/4" x Diameter 10". |

Meiji Period Large Bronze Mixed Metal Usubata by Shigeyuki |
 |
Inventory #: U-1792 |
Giant Bronze Flower Holder of Usubata with superb gold, silver and mixed metal work. Depicting court people under cherry tree and birds & flowers on other side with hanging gold poem card signature. Signed Tokyo-Ju and Shojusai Shigeyuki. (nonesusu) |

JAPANESE 20TH CENTURY BRONZE OKIMONO OF RAM |
 |
Inventory #: B2U-26 |
Japanese 20th century bronze OKIMONO of a ram. The ram is done in fine detail. The OKIMONO is signed on the bottom KOUMEI-saku. The OKIMONO measures 10 1/4" wide, 7" deep and 7 1/8" tall. |
